> I'm trying to run the latest download using JRuby 1.1.5 + Rails 2.1.2
> (after commenting Rails version in environment.rb) and see the
> following errors:
>
> /Users/arungupta/tools/jruby-1.1.5/bin/rake:19
> no such file to load -- ferret_ext
> /Users/arungupta/tools/jruby-1.1.5/lib/ruby/gems/1.8/gems/
> activesupport-2.1.2/lib/active_support/dependencies.rb:513:in
> `require'
> /Users/arungupta/tools/jruby-1.1.5/lib/ruby/gems/1.8/gems/rails-2.1.2/
> lib/rails/gem_dependency.rb:61:in `load'
> /Users/arungupta/tools/jruby-1.1.5/lib/ruby/gems/1.8/gems/rails-2.1.2/
> lib/initializer.rb:250:in `load_gems'
>
> And similarly for "hpricot_scan" as well.
>
> What am I missing ?
>
> Has lovdbyless been tested with JRuby ?
>
> -Arun

Lovd has not been tested with jruby, but it shouldn't have to be, that
is the promise of jruby. It looks like you need to install the ferret
gem into jruby.
